Rocksauce Fiery Hot Pain Relief

Last content change checked dailysee data sync status

Active ingredients
  • Capsaicin 0.0018 g/88.5 mL
  • Menthol 9.02 g/88.5 mL
  • Methyl Salicylate 18 g/88.5 mL
Dosage form
Cream
Route
Topical
Prescription status
OTC (over the counter)
Marketed in the U.S.
Since 2021
Label revision date
April 7, 2025

Dosage and Administration

To use this lotion effectively, start by applying a generous amount directly to the area where you feel pain. Make sure to massage the lotion into your skin until it is fully absorbed. For the best results, you should repeat this process three to four times a day.

It's important to store the lotion properly to maintain its effectiveness. Keep it in a cool place, ideally between 68° to 77°F (20° to 25°C). Following these steps will help you manage your pain effectively.

What to Avoid

It's important to be aware of certain precautions when using this product. First, do not use it if you are a child aged 5 years or younger. Always follow the directions provided; using the product in any way other than as directed can be harmful.

When using this product, avoid heating it, microwaving it, or adding it to hot water, as this can cause splattering and burns. Additionally, do not apply it to your eyes or directly on mucous membranes, and refrain from taking it by mouth or placing it in your nostrils. It should also not be applied to wounds or damaged skin. Following these guidelines will help ensure your safety while using the product.

Contraindications

Use of this product is contraindicated in the following situations:

  • The product is not intended for use in children aged 5 years or younger.

  • Administration should strictly adhere to the provided directions; any deviation is contraindicated.

  • Heating, microwaving, or adding the product to hot water or any container that may cause splattering, leading to burns, is prohibited.

  • Direct application to the eyes or mucus membranes is contraindicated.

  • The product should not be ingested or placed in the nostrils.

  • Application to wounds or damaged skin is not recommended.
